Course Description:
This one day course was developed to provide ad operations professionals from publishers, ad agencies, ad networks and other companies with a high level overview of the key activities required to manage a campaign and the fundamentals around effective media optimization.
The course will begin with an overview of campaign management and a basic understanding of media
optimization and its importance to the success of a campaign and then go into deeper discussion about
identifying under-performing placements and/or ads, understanding performance and managing conversion
optimization, utilization of reports to make necessary recommendations on program and placement reallocations,
identifying and troubleshooting problems with ads and other issues that can cause under-delivery.
Who Should Attend?:
This course will be beneficial to account coordinators and account managers who have been in their role for more than 6 months and/or other ad operations staff seeking to expand their knowledge.

About the Instructor:

Virgil Waters has 10 years experience focused on Internet Advertising, Marketing, Search and Web Technologies, and comes from an IT background with over 18 years software development and implementation experience. Virgil has worked extensively with DART Enterprise 6.5, custom commercial ad-serving, search, behavioral targeting, rich-media and ad operations work-flow solutions.
